This video utilizes a soccer team and a
band to help understand how combinations and permutations work. Coaches
sometimes assign very specific roles, such as left midfield, right midfield,
and center midfield, while others just say you three go play midfield. The
presenter is able to explain how this mathematically creates a large
difference. Allowing the players to choose their specific positions on an 11
player team changes the possibilities from 11 x 10 x 9 x 8 to (11 x 10 x 9 x
8)/(4 x 3 x 2 x 1). The presenter then explains that Pascal’s Triangle can also
be used to calculate combinations. For example, to find out what choosing 2
from 4 is, count down 4 rows then over 2 numbers. The same simple processes of
adding numbers together produce all sorts of things that we can see around us
in the world.
